AdventHealth Waterman Welcomes First Baby Born in 2026

The start of 2026 brought a moment of celebration at AdventHealth Waterman, where their first baby of the new year was born in the early hours of New Year’s Day.
Baby boy Hayden Shane Overfield was born at 1:18 a.m. to parents Nichole and James Overfield of Grand Island. Hayden weighed 5 pounds, 2 ounces and measured 18.5 inches long.
Hospital staff marked the milestone with the family, celebrating a joyful beginning to the new year and a meaningful first arrival for Lake County in 2026.
